This button allows you to remove the selected station (Refer to the CAUTION
earlier in this section). You may remove any station address except that
belonging to the device itself, or a station from the Allowed Stations window if
the security is set to Enable with Alarm. A symbol (-) indicates that this
station has been marked for removal, and will remain until the changes are
applied, at which time the station is actually removed from the window.
Selecting the station and clicking on the ADD button will remove the symbol
(-) and unmark the station for removal. This button will also remove a station
marked with the symbol (+).
This button allows you to remove all of the stations in the Allowed Stations
window (Refer to the CAUTION earlier in this section). A symbol (-) marks all
of the items in the window, indicating that the stations have been designated
for removal, and will remain until the changes are applied, at which time the
stations are actually removed from the window. This option will remove all
station addresses except that belonging to the device itself. Selecting a station
and clicking on the ADD button will remove the symbol (-) and unmark that
station for removal.
This button applies all changes made to the Allowed and Disallowed Stations
windows, writing the list from the Allowed Stations window to the device and
from the Disallowed Stations window to SPECTRUM, and removes all
indicator markings from the modified stations.
This button updates the Allowed and Disallowed Stations windows by reading
the saved values from both the device and SPECTRUM. This serves to reset
any changes you made to either window but did not apply.
This button will allow you to exit from the view. Only changes that have been
applied will be saved.
